Previously, we were always using string comparisons, and hard-coded
paths to temp locations on non-Windows platforms. This was
problematic for a few reasons. We had to maintain a list of temp
locations for the various platforms, and the string comparisons were
unreliable on Windows, since paths have two string representations
(the "short" name containing a ~ followed by a number, and the "full"
name).
By getting the current temp location using Dir.tempdir (the same
mechanism our temp creation code uses), we no longer need to maintain
the list of temp locations. Also, rather than doing string
comparisons on file paths, we can use a combination of
Pathname#ascend, and File.identical? to determine if the path
registered as a temp file for deletion was actually created in the
temp location.
With this refactoring, the same code now works for both Windows, and
non-Windows platforms.

Ruby 1.8.7 is fairly lax about various bits of introspection, including that
we can't tell much about what arguments a block takes. Ruby 1.9.2 makes it
possible to do this, though.
Meanwhile, the Faces system uses this to make sure that scripts and actions
take the right set of arguments, to avoid surprises: failing early and
explicitly is better than failing at runtime.
Which, in final turn, exposes that I forgot to accept the right arguments in a
couple of my testing actions for Faces, but didn't notice because 1.8.7
doesn't check that, and I didn't test on 1.9.2.

Absolute paths on Unix, e.g. /foo/bar, are not absolute on Windows,
which breaks many test cases. This commit adds a method to
PuppetSpec::Files.make_absolute that makes the path absolute in
test cases.
On Unix (Puppet.features.posix?) it is a no-op. On Windows,
(Puppet.features.microsoft_windows?) the drive from the current
working directory is prepended.

"Invisible glob", or "prefix", version matching means that when you specify a
version string to use you can specify as little as one version number out of
the semantic versioning spec.
Matching is done on the prefix; an omitted number is treated as "anything" in
that slot, and we return the highest matching versioned face by that spec.
For example, given the set of versions: 1.0.0, 1.0.1, 1.1.0, 1.1.1, 2.0.0
The following would be matched:
input matched
1 1.1.1
1.0 1.0.1
1.0.1 1.0.1
1.0.2 fail - no match
1.1 1.1.1
1.1.1 1.1.1
1.2 fail - no match

Options can now add before_action and after_action blocks; these are invoked
before or after any action is invoked on the face. This allows these options
to declare common behaviour and have it automatically applied to the actions
invoked.
Option hooks have no defined order of invocation: they will run in a
completely random order. Where there are dependencies they should be on the
value of the options hash passed to the invocation, not on side-effects of the
other invocations.
You are not able to influence the arguments, options, or calling of the action
body in a before or after decorator. This is by design.
The invocation passes to the hook:
1. The action object representing this action.
2. The arguments to the action, as an array.
3. The options for the action, as a hash.

We used to shell out to chmod and rm to clean up temporary files; this lead to
the cleanup method here being one of the largest consumers of walltime.
Replacing that with FileUtil calls is as, or more, secure, and performs
sufficiently well that we can just delegate.

The function import_if_possible, which was supposed to be responsible
for making sure that no two threads tried to import the same file at
the same time, was not making this decision based on the full pathname
of the file, since it was being invoked before pathnames were
resolved. As a result, if we attempted to import two distinct files
with the same name at the same time (either in two threads or in a
single thread due to recursion), one of the files would not always get
imported.
Fixed this problem by moving the thread-safety logic to happen after
filenames are resolved to absolute paths. This made it possible to
simplify the thread-safety logic significantly.
